Perplexity Computer is equipped with a variety of features that enhance productivity and streamline AI-driven workflows. These features are designed to cater to both individual users and businesses, offering practical solutions for diverse needs:
- Human-like Web Browsing: The system mimics human browsing behavior, bypassing website restrictions through advanced proxy systems and virtual machine (VM) architecture. This capability is particularly effective for web-based research, data collection and automation tasks.
- File Generation: It supports the creation of diverse file types, including PDFs, images and videos, allowing users to meet a wide range of professional and creative requirements.
- Software Integration: Seamlessly integrates with over 400 tools, such as Slack, Gmail and GitHub, allowing users to maintain smooth workflows across multiple platforms without manual intervention.
- Task Parallelization: A sub-agent architecture enables multiple processes to run simultaneously, significantly improving efficiency for complex or multi-layered projects.
- Persistent Memory: Retains context across sessions, making it ideal for long-term projects that require continuity and semantic understanding.
Technical Architecture: How It Works
The technical framework of Perplexity Computer is designed to prioritize security, efficiency and adaptability. Its architecture incorporates several advanced components to ensure reliable performance:
- Dual Virtual Machines (VMs): Tasks are isolated across two VMs to enhance security and reduce the risk of interference or data breaches. This separation ensures that sensitive operations remain protected.
- Dynamic Task Routing: The orchestrator model, Opus 4.6, dynamically routes tasks to 19 AI models, selecting the most suitable one for each operation. This ensures that tasks are handled with optimal precision and speed.
- Model Council Integration: Inspired by Perplexity’s Model Council, the system synthesizes outputs from multiple AI models to improve reliability, accuracy and overall performance.

Limitations to Consider
Despite its strengths, Perplexity Computer has certain limitations that potential users should carefully evaluate before adopting the tool:
- High Cost: At $200 per month, the subscription fee may not be affordable for all users, particularly those with extensive usage needs or limited budgets.
- Functional Gaps: The system struggles with specific tasks, such as advanced GitHub integration and file system management, which can limit its effectiveness in certain scenarios.
- Privacy Concerns: Compared to open source alternatives like Agent Zero or OpenClaw, Perplexity Computer offers less control over data security, which may be a concern for privacy-conscious users.
- Early-Stage Challenges: As a relatively new product, it occasionally experiences inefficiencies and bugs that can disrupt workflows or reduce reliability.
